#abcd63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#abcd63 is composed of 67.1% red, 80.4%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.7%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 79.2 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 59.6%. #abcd63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#579b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#abcd63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#abcd63 has RGB values of R:171, G:205,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 11259235.

Shades and Tints of #abcd63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060702 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f8 is the lightest one.
